Grooming and Coat Care
Yorkie Poos boast a variety of coat types, from wavy to curly. Regular grooming is necessary to prevent matting and keep their coats healthy.
Brush Regularly: Use a slicker brush to reduce tangling. Go for a minimum of 2-3 times a week.Bathing: Bathe your Yorkie Poo every 4-6 weeks, using a mild dog shampoo.Expert Grooming: Many owners choose professional grooming every few months, specifically for haircuts.Nutrition
A balanced diet plan is important for the health of a Yorkie Poo. High-quality pet dog food created for little breeds will offer the necessary nutrients.
Workout Needs
In spite of their little size, Yorkie Poos require daily workout to remain healthy and pleased. A mix of walks and playtime is ideal.
Daily Walks: A brisk walk for 15-30 minutes.Interactive Play: Engage in activities like bring or hide-and-seek.Training
Starting training early is essential for Yorkie Poos. Their eagerness to please makes them responsive to commands.
Training Tips:Start Early: Begin training and socialization as quickly as you bring your puppy home.Favorable Reinforcement: Use treats and praise to encourage etiquette.Consistency: Be consistent with commands and routines.Brief Sessions: Keep training sessions brief (5-10 minutes) to maintain their interest.Health Considerations

Yes, Yorkie Poos normally have low-shedding coats, that makes them a good alternative for allergy patients.
Q2: How much do Yorkie Poos typically weigh?
Yorkie Poos can weigh anywhere from 4 to 15 pounds, depending upon the size of their Poodle moms and dad.
Q3: Do Yorkie Poos need a lot of workout?
While they are small dogs, Yorkie Poos need moderate exercise, ideally around 30 minutes a day.
Q4: How often should Yorkie Poos be groomed?
They should be groomed frequently, at least 2-3 times a week, and might need expert grooming every few months.
